Golden Chicken Stroganoff with Crispy Potato Sticks

A quick and creamy Brazilian-style chicken stroganoff, featuring tender chicken in a savory sauce, served over fluffy white rice and topped with crispy potato sticks.

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1.5 pound chicken breast (boneless, skinless, cut into 1-inch pieces)
- 0.75 teaspoon salt (divided)
- 0.25 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 yellow onion (medium, diced)
- 8 ounce cremini mushrooms (sliced)
- 0.25 cup tomato paste
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 0.5 cup ketchup
- 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
- 2 cup white rice (uncooked)
- 4 cup water
- 5 ounce crispy potato sticks
Instructions
- Begin cooking the rice: In a medium saucepan, combine 2 cups white rice, 4 cups water, and 1/4 teaspoon salt. Bring to a boil over high heat, then re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15-18 minutes, or until water is absorbed and rice is tender. Remove from heat and keep covered.
- While the rice cooks, heat 1 tablespoon olive oil in a large skillet or pot over medium-high heat. Season the 1 and 1/2 pounds chicken breast pieces with 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on black pepper. Add to the hot skillet and cook, stirring occasionally, until browned on all sides, about 5-7 minutes.
- Add the diced yellow onion to the skillet and cook until softened, about 3 minutes. Stir in the sliced cremini mushrooms and cook for another 3-4 minutes until they begin to release their liquid.
- Stir in the 1/4 cup tomato paste and cook for 1 minute, ensuring it coats the chicken and vegetables. Pour in the 1 cup heavy cream, 1/2 cup ketchup, and 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ard. Stir well to combine. Bring the sauce to a gentle simmer and cook for 2-3 minutes, allowing it to thicken slightly.
- Season with the rem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t, or to taste. Remove from heat.
- Serve the chicken stroganoff immediately over the fluffy white rice. Top generously with crispy potato sticks before serving.
Notes
Leftovers can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days, though potato sticks are best added just before serving to maintain crispness.
